Delicacies from the region
Pizza swirls, chocolate croissants, craft beer and wine - food that makes us happy. At the Industry Night, you can experience how they are produced in the Basel region. You’ll find fresh craft beer brewed daily at Volta Bräu, where you can enjoy these beers on tap. Discover the art of beer brewing at Brewpub on Voltaplatz, ask the master brewer all of your questions, and brew your own beer! Birtel also makes excellent craft beer. This Dreispitz-based beer manufacturer uses their own hops and malting barley, with all their raw materials grown in Switzerland. At Industry Night the team will explain each step of how this popular drink is produced. Next, you’ll sample Birtel’s offerings at Fahrbar. vinigma’s wine cellar is located nearby, also in Dreispitz. This urban winery harvests red and white grapes from their own vineyards in Jenins and purchases grapes from both Aesch in the Basel region and Valais. At Industry Night, see how these winemakers produce their characterful wines: from the grape delivery and the pressing to the labelling of bottles. And of course, you’ll have a chance to taste the wines yourself.

Alongside the wine and beer cellars, regional bakeries are also opening their doors at Industry Night. Experience a day in the life of a modern baker at Sutter Begg in the Dreispitz area. This bakery is a family business founded over 100 years ago, with twenty-seven branches in the region. Take an exclusive tour through the bakery and try your hand at making pastries and baking. Bäckerei KULT is known for its delicious sourdough breads, with a new branch just opened in Voltaplatz. A varied programme awaits you at Industry Night. Sample the bread selection, have a go kneading the dough and braid a plait or try your hand at foaming milk at the barista station. And don’t forget the most important part: the tasting!
Last but not least, discover a craft with a rich history at Ricola. This famous producer of herbal sweets and herbal and instant teas was founded in 1930 and operates in more than fifty countries worldwide today. Their head office is still located in Laufen. In fact, their connection with the region remains clear in the name itself “Ri-co-la” (Richterich Compagnie Laufen). Ricola exclusively uses herbs from the Swiss mountain regions. At Industry Night in Messeplatz you can come and see how their herbal sugar is produced from the original recipe – of course, with a chance to taste it yourself.
